Sidmouth Road is in Chelmsford and in Chelmsford district. CM1 6LS is located in the The Lawns elect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Chelmsford. This postcode has been in use since 1995-07-01.

Is Sidmouth Road d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Sidmouth Road was 30.3 per 1,000 residents, which is 34.7% lower than the Springfield North average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Sidmouth Road has the 27th lowest crime rate of 54 local areas in Springfield North and the 189th lowest crime rate of 549 local areas in Chelmsford .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 15.2 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 24.0%.

CM1 6LS area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 3%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.

The percentage of retired residents living in CM1 6LS area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 39%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
